Niecy Nash-Betts and partner Jessica Betts chat with THR at the Disney post-Emmys carpet and tease her new show 'Grotesquerie' and working with Ryan Murphy. Plus, she talks working with Kansas City Chiefs player Travis Kelce and going to a football game.
00:00The premiere of Grotesquerie is coming so soon.
00:02What can you tease about this show?
00:05I can tell you that you will see me play a character you've never seen me play before.
00:09Although I've played many cops, this one is very different.
00:14Yeah, it's dark, it's haunting, and at some point you can't look away.
